Now back to the topic, BUGS -
AI uses Reanimate to get a Lightning Bolt. It loses 1 life and Lightning Bolt doesn't deal damage and stays on the table as if it were some enchantment, maybe there's a problem with valid targets.
AI -
I also noticed standard AI behavior didn't evolve much since last time.
Not pseudo card knowledge, but I think it's possible to develop some kind of Threat mechanic (at least for creatures).
For instance AI just burned a Vampire Lacerator with a Lightning Bolt, while I had a Vampire Nighthawk on the table, not only has better stats, it also has flying and deathtouch, applying that mechanic here is easy, and wouldn't make AI look like really stupid or drunk. Something like: a 2/2 creature with a tag ability (flying/flanking/bushido/trample/frist strike/life link/deathtouch/...) is better than an ordinary 2/2.
Although there are much much more complex ones that we would love to see, but would be a pain in the arse to make
we won't be talking about that.
Example: player has a Boggart Ram-Gang and a Dragonmaster Outcast and 5 or more lands on the table, it would be nice that the AI tries to kill Dragonmaster Outcast to stop token creation instead of Boggart Ram-Gang.

by friarsol » 04 Oct 2010, 19:20
This seems legit. Old Man is 3/4. He steals Talas Warrior. Talas Warrior get bumped up to 4/4 due to the Scimitar and the Liege. Old Man can't control him any more, so he releases. Talas Warrior goes back to your opponent and is 3/3 again.indicatie wrote:I had a 3/4 (due to Glen Elendra Liege) Old Man of the Sea , but I could not take control of a 3/3 (due to Leonin Scimitar) Talas Warrior.
